The History of Cos Winery

Cos Winery has its roots in Sicilian winemaking tradition, skillfully blending heritage and innovation. Founded in the heart of Sicily, this winery stands out for its commitment to preserving local winemaking traditions, while integrating modern techniques that enhance the quality of the final product.

Production Philosophy

Cos's production philosophy is a perfect balance between traditional and modern approaches with an eye towards sustainability. The company is dedicated to organic farming, reducing environmental impact and respecting the ecosystem. In simpler terms, it's like reconciling grandma's habits with twenty-first-century technologies, producing a product that speaks of both the past and the future.

Cos's Iconic Wines

Cos winery is renowned for some distinctive labels that well represent its philosophy. Among the iconic wines, we find:

  • Cerasuolo di Vittoria Classico DOCG: A vibrant wine that combines the sweetness of Frappato with the structure of Nero d'Avola.
  • Pithos Bianco: Aged in terracotta amphorae, it brings ancestral tradition to the glass with a touch of modernity.
  • Zibibbo in Pithos: An aromatic and persistent white, perfect for those seeking new tasting experiences.

Storing Cos Wines

For those who want to know how to store Cos wines, here are some helpful tips. It is essential to keep the bottle in a cool, dark environment, preferably with a stable temperature around 12-16°C for reds and slightly lower for whites. Similar to guarding a treasure, ideal humidity is around 70%, ensuring bottles are horizontal to keep the cork moist.
